CPGjoblist adds sales, marketing executives
Recruiting services firm expanding its industry
PASADENA, CALIF. -- CPGjoblist, the consumer packaged goods industry's leading recruiting services firm, has expanded its sales and marketing team to help it "respond to increased market demand."
Jackie Apodaca, former Senior Program Development Manager for Omnicom, has been named the firm's Director of Marketing, reporting to company President Michael Carrillo.
Spencer Blaker, former Customer Marketing Manager for Dreyer's Grand Ice Cream, Inc., has been appointed Director of Sales, Northeastern Region, for CPGjoblist.
Tom Chisari, veteran CPG industry executive and Vice President, National Sales and Distribution for Eco Woods California, Ltd., will assume the post of Director of Sales, Specialty Markets, in March.
The new executive expansion of the sales team at CPGjoblist will also consist of Shelley Guidarelli, who has been promoted to Director of Business Development. Guidarelli has more than twenty years of experience placing mid to senior level sales and marketing management talent in the CPG industry.
Blaker, Chisari and Guidarelli will report to Tami Page, Vice President of Sales for CPGjoblist.

Jackie Apodaca has more than 10 years of experience in consumer product marketing management. As a Senior Program Development Manager at Omnicom, she headed the retail associate training for CompUSA and Staples along with managing online training for several electronic companies including; Canon, Toshiba, and Pentax. At Disney, she led the retail marketing/merchandising efforts, and prior to that was a Product Marketing Manager for international product lines. She holds a Masters of Business Administration in General Business and a Bachelor of Business Administration in Marketing from New Mexico State University.
Sales experience
Spencer Blaker, CPGjoblist's newly appointed Director of Sales, Northeastern Region, brings more than 16 years of CPG experience, has held sales positions at some of the consumer industry's top companies. In addition to his recent service at Dreyer's Grand Ice Cream where he developed customer-centric shopping programs, he has served as a team leader for Procter & Gamble and The Gillette Company, where he help manage retail strategy for Oral B/ Braun. Blaker has also held sales leadership positions at Nestle, Purina Petcare and Nabisco.
Thomas Chisari, CPGjoblist's newly appointed Director of Sales, Specialty Accounts, has broad experience in sales management, merchandising and brand building. As Vice-President, National Sales and Distribution, for Eco Woods California, he helped develop and launch new consumer products and oversaw day-to-day operations of the company. Prior to that, he was a Vice-President of the vending firm, The Amusement Factory, and has been a top executive with Storecast Merchandising Corporation, and a Senior Consultant / Business Leader for Daymon Worldwide.
